Taking these out of the box, you might think you've made a mistake. They feel very light in the hand and instructions are no more than a leaflet. You will be pleasantly surprised after you connect and get the PNP set up out of the way. The sound is very good; the phones are light on the head and do a good job of blocking ambient noise. The bass response is very good, and the automatic limiter is appreciated after you blow up something big in a video game.
Negatives: No “on board” volume control, you have to adjust the system volume properties.
Well worth the money for gaming or DVD/Music consumption.
